The similarity between the French name for the city that English-speakers have also adopted ("Cologne") and the fragrance is no accident: Cologne's is its birthplace. And "No. 4711" just happens to be the oldest and best-known brand. At this venerable house with its gold-plated, cologne-bubbling fountain, the traveler can join the around 60,000 visitors a year and sniff through the impressive selection of perfumes, colognes, and other fragrances. A fragrance workshop is also offered.
